Lara rescued a tribal youth from Trinity forces in the forest, earning the trust of a local tribe. They guided her blindfolded to the spectacular hidden city of Paititi. There, Lara met the queen, explained her mission against Trinity, reunited with Jonah, and received authentic local attire.
Right when Lara was trying to help the young boy from a local tribe was trapped, someone tried to ambush Lara and she handled the situation smoothly with some arrow shots.
After taking care of that man, Lara noticed the insignia of Trinity on him so she got confirmed that man works for Trinity though he's not the modern age men.
More enemies suddenly appeared and just when things looked dire, members of a local tribe emerged and shot all of the enemies at once, effectively rescuing Lara and the kid.
The tribe found Lara a little trustworthy but to ensure the absolute secrecy of their home, the tribe blindfolded Lara before leading her to their sanctuary.
It became clear that the youth Lara saved belonged to this native tribe. The boy's mother, who appeared to be a prominent leader or queen of the community, arrived wearing an intricate, full caped outfit.
She questioned Lara closely, asking what her purpose was in their territory and how she managed to find this secluded location if she was not affiliated with the Cult. Lara spoke the truth and explained that she was a researcher.
They brought Jonah in, and Lara felt immense relief to find her friend safe and unharmed. The queen then commanded her son to provide Lara with proper local clothing and ordered the guards to keep Jonah company.
To prove her point, Lara showed a photograph of an insignia. The queen recognized it and mentioned the name Paititi, the legendary hidden city.
Lara questioned her about the serpent with the silver eye, but the queen warned her that it was a place of death and sacrifice, noting that no one who went there ever returned.
Despite the grave warning, Lara insisted she was willing to try because her primary goal was simply to stop the Cult.

Lara changed into the beautifully crafted tribal clothes, making her look exactly like one of the locals and the queen decided to take a walk with her.
As she stepped out into the open, she was amazed to discover a massive, vibrant village hidden within the city, filled with numerous villagers living their lives completely cut off from the modern world.
